Escalation (stale-cache postmortem, Lanternfox checkout): if users report prices from yesterday, first check the Emberline cache layer's invalidation queue depth. Over 10k pending entries means the purge worker stalled again — the same failure mode from the March incident. Restart the worker, confirm queue drain, then page the on-call lead. For postmortem doc access, email the reliability coordinator.

escalation mailbox, yajeg-bageg: quenax.olidor@lumiccorp.internal

### Step 4: Update the LockerLine access flow

On-call: after the gateway swap in Step 3, the Tumblebay laundry-locker access flow must point at the new token broker. Residents unlock via the short-lived QR path now; the legacy PIN fallback stays enabled for two weeks. Verify that unlock latency stays under two seconds on the pilot bank before proceeding. Apply the configuration values shown below to every kiosk in the pilot.

deployment values, hahip-kajep:
HOLAX_PIN=4003
HOLAX_METRICS_HOST=metrics.holax.zemvarworks.internal
HOLAX_LOG_LEVEL=warn
HOLAX_TENANT=fraael

## Deployment Notes: The Great FD Hunt

Heads up for security review: Tanglewood's exporter used to leak file descriptors whenever an upstream socket timed out mid-handshake, and we'd hit the ulimit after about a week. Marek traced it to an unclosed pipe in the retry path; that's fixed, but we also added belt-and-suspenders limits and a watchdog that logs FD counts every minute. Deployments now ship with tightened descriptor settings, reproduced here for audit purposes.

service settings:
HOLDOR_PIN=6477
HOLDOR_METRICS_HOST=metrics.holdor.nelvrocorp.corp
HOLDOR_LOG_LEVEL=error
HOLDOR_TENANT=noviel